質問 > フロント機能 > メルマガ送信3000件の壁。 |
フロント機能
スレッド表示 | 新しいものから | 前のトピック | 次のトピック | 下へ |
投稿者 | スレッド |
---|---|
nacho |
投稿日時: 2009/12/4 15:10
対応状況: −−−
|
一人前 登録日: 2008/12/8 居住地: 投稿: 103 |
メルマガ送信3000件の壁。 EC-CUBE 2.3.0
いつもお世話になっております。 過去ログの方も参考にさせていただいたのですが メルマガ登録数が、3000件以上になった途端 送信中に画面が真っ白で左上に「start sending」というメッセージがあり その後、別途ログインしてメルマガの配信履歴を見ると 配信予定件数が3000件以上なのに対し配信件数は 2900件位になっており、一部にメルマガが送信出来ていない 状態のようです。 過去ログ http://xoops.ec-cube.net/modules/newbb/viewtopic.php?viewmode=flat&topic_id=716&forum=1 こちらも参考にさせていただき、試してみたのですが 今度は画面が真っ白で「start sending」というメッセージが 出なくなっただけで、状況は変わりませんでした。 タイムアウトが原因では?というのが過去ログを見ていて 判ったのですが、ではタイムアウトをどのように操作すれば 改善出来るのかが理解出来ずにおります。 他の過去ログでも3000件あたりで送信できなくなったという 書き込みがありまりたが、解決策が投稿されておらず 困っております。 どうぞ宜しくお願い致します。 |
seasoft |
投稿日時: 2009/12/4 17:10
対応状況: −−−
|
神 登録日: 2008/6/4 居住地: 投稿: 7367 |
Re: メルマガ送信3000件の壁。 PHP やウェブサーバのタイムアウトを延長するというのはいかがでしょう?
PHP に関しては、EC-CUBEコミュニティ(eccube-comu) の郵便番号の登録処理など、参考になるかもしれません。 また、大量送信向けに EC-CUBE との連携サービス業者もあったと思います。
|
Yammy |
投稿日時: 2009/12/4 19:06
対応状況: −−−
|
半人前 登録日: 2008/2/18 居住地: 大阪 投稿: 30 |
Re: メルマガ送信3000件の壁。 一度、dtb_send_history にメルマガ配信対象データを登録後、配信時に対象データを更新するのですが、インデックスもプライマリキーも設定がないため、配信をしたという更新に時間がかかっているからだと思います。
メルマガ配信対象データが格納されている dtb_send_history の send_id に対して、プライマリキーを設定してみてください。 以前20,000通くらいのメルマガ配信が1,2時間かかり、かつ途中で止まっていましたが、この方法で数分で配信が完了しました。
|
popo |
投稿日時: 2009/12/4 21:10
対応状況: −−−
|
長老 登録日: 2008/10/1 居住地: 投稿: 189 |
Re: メルマガ送信3000件の壁。 横からすみません。
私もメルマガ配信に時間がかかってしまうため、メルマガ配信をするのをやめてしまっていました。 「dtb_send_history の send_id に対して、プライマリキーを設定」と言うのは、具体的にどのようにすれば良いのでしょうか? 「send_id」に「1」を設定すれば良いのでしょうか? 現在は、「send_id」には配信したメルマガの順番に番号は入っています。 アドバイスを頂けると助かります。 |
seasoft |
投稿日時: 2009/12/4 22:05
対応状況: −−−
|
神 登録日: 2008/6/4 居住地: 投稿: 7367 |
Re: メルマガ送信3000件の壁。 > 「send_id」に「1」を設定すれば良いのでしょうか?
いいえ。 この辺が参考になりそうな予感。 http://ja.wikipedia.org/wiki/%E4%B8%BB%E3%82%AD%E3%83%BC http://www.google.co.jp/search?q=mysql+%83v%83%89%83C%83}%83%8A%83L%81[+%90%DD%92%E8
|
nacho |
投稿日時: 2009/12/5 15:30
対応状況: −−−
|
一人前 登録日: 2008/12/8 居住地: 投稿: 103 |
Re: メルマガ送信3000件の壁。 seasoft様
いつも、的確な道しるべをありがとうございます。 教えて頂きました 「EC-CUBEコミュニティ(eccube-comu) の郵便番号の登録処理」 というのは、どこで見られますか? 的外れな質問で申し訳ありません。 リンクしていただいたページのどこの部分から 検索すればよいのかわからずにおります。 お時間がございましたら教えてください。 Yammy様 お返事いただきありがとうございます。 初歩的な質問で申し訳ないのですが 教えてください。 当方、phpMyAdminでMySQLを管理しているのですが 「dtb_send_history の send_id に対して、プライマリキーを設定」 というのは順序としては 左側の「ec_webmaster」クリックして 「dtb_send_history」を選択 「send_id」の右端のアイコン(鍵のマーク)「主」を選択 でよろしいでしょうか? 何分初心者なもので、これで大丈夫かとても心配です。 選択すると「本当に実行しますか?」という表示が出てきて 更に不安に・・・。 どうぞ宜しくお願いします。 |
seasoft |
投稿日時: 2009/12/5 18:42
対応状況: −−−
|
神 登録日: 2008/6/4 居住地: 投稿: 7367 |
Re: メルマガ送信3000件の壁。 話が錯綜してしまいましたね。
> 「EC-CUBEコミュニティ(eccube-comu) の郵便番号の登録処理」 > というのは、どこで見られますか? ファイルとしては、EC-CUBEコミュニティ(eccube-comu) ナイトリービルド を展開した、\data\class\pages\admin\basis\LC_Page_Admin_Basis_ZipInstall.php です。 PHP のタイムアウトを比較的安全に延長する試みをしています。 WEB サーバのタイムアウトを延長するには、別の設定が必要になってきます。 > 的外れな質問で申し訳ありません。 > リンクしていただいたページのどこの部分から > 検索すればよいのかわからずにおります。 貼っておいたリンクは、「プライマリキー(主キー)」の説明でした。
|
nacho |
投稿日時: 2009/12/9 14:20
対応状況: −−−
|
一人前 登録日: 2008/12/8 居住地: 投稿: 103 |
Re: メルマガ送信3000件の壁。 プライマリキーの設定をしてみたのですが
症状は改善されませんでした。 seasoft様より、お教え頂いた 「EC-CUBEコミュニティ」は登録が必要との事で 現在申請中です。 また、後日チャレンジする予定です。 進展がありましたらご報告させて頂きたいと思います<(_ _)> |
AMUAMU |
投稿日時: 2009/12/9 15:00
対応状況: −−−
|
神 登録日: 2009/5/2 居住地: 東京都 投稿: 2712 |
Re: メルマガ送信3000件の壁。 http://www.ec-cube.net/download/index.php
の画面下部、「EC-CUBEコミュニティ ナイトリービルド版」で登録等無くダウンロード出来ますよ
|
nacho |
投稿日時: 2009/12/14 14:27
対応状況: −−−
|
一人前 登録日: 2008/12/8 居住地: 投稿: 103 |
Re: メルマガ送信3000件の壁。 AMUAMU様
ご丁寧にありがとうございます<(_ _)> 「ナイトリービルド版 eccube-comu-r18437 」 をダウンロードしてみたのですが ファイルを開く事が出来ずにおります。 それで、登録が必要なのかと勘違いしてしまいました。 ナイトリービルド版というものがいまいち良く判っておらず お恥ずかしい話です。 このファイルを見る為にはどのような環境が必要なのでしょうか? ご教授いただけますと幸いです。 |
(1) 2 » |
スレッド表示 | 新しいものから | 前のトピック | 次のトピック | トップ |